  • 9 Sept 06 - Starship Social Enterprise is the headline of a Sept 21 2006 article written by Camilla Cavendish on the Times Online website. She refers to people like us as 'a polite guerrilla army is on the march. From Glasgow to Great Torrington, from Dartford to Darlington, citizens are arming themselves with pencils and tomes of planning law and campaigning to preserve their streets and open spaces'. She goes on to describe how 'land which has been held in trust for the public, but which is now worth so much to developers that councillors start burbling about job creation at the merest hint of a cheque', which is what we are seeing here in Lancaster.
